I know some of you are really high on some players in the minors for the Giants, but from my point of view, the Giants have exactly no one in their minor league system who looks like a can't miss player. There are zero impact players in the system right now.
I bring this up because, according to USA today, Cubs GM Theo Epstein has told other GMs that Jeff Samardjia is off limits, but other than him, the entire roster is available. Included in that proclamation is this nugget: "Shortstop Starlin Castro already is a star at 22 but can be obtained for two impact prospects."
I would move heaven and Earth to obtain Castro. But somehow I just don't think that Epstein considers Gary Brown, Tommy Joseph or Heath Hembree to be those impact players. Honestly, I would offer all three plus Peguero for Castro.
